Sarah Paulson to Portray Aileen Wuornos in New True Crime Thriller ‘Monster: Lizzie Borden’

Sarah Paulson is reuniting with Ryan Murphy for the fourth season of Netflix’s true crime anthology, Monster: The Lizzie Borden Story. The Emmy-winning actress is close to signing on to portray serial killer Aileen Wuornos, adding a chilling layer to the series.

According to Variety, Wuornos won’t be the season’s main focus. Instead, the show will explore Lizzie Borden’s influence on the perception of female killers, similar to how Season 3 examined Ed Gein’s impact on popular culture.

Monster: Lizzie Borden centers on the infamous 1892 axe murders of Borden’s father and stepmother. Production is currently underway in Los Angeles, with Ella Beatty starring as Lizzie, Charlie Hunnam as her father, Rebecca Hall as her stepmother, Billie Lourd as her sister, Jessica Barden as a close friend, and Vicky Krieps as the family’s maid.

Aileen Wuornos, who killed seven men in Florida between 1989 and 1990, was executed in 2002 after over a decade on death row. The character has been famously portrayed by Charlize Theron in Monster (2003), earning her an Academy Award. Other portrayals include Peyton List, Jean Smart, and Lily Rabe (the latter in American Horror Story Season 5).

Paulson is also set to return to American Horror Story for its 13th season.

The Monster series launched in 2022 with The Jeffrey Dahmer Story, followed by The Lyle and Erik Menendez Story in 2024, and The Ed Gein Story last month, cementing the franchise as a must-watch for true crime fans.
